This refers to ‘Substance over form’ (January 20). The recent Supreme Court ruling in the Tiger Global matter once again brings the doctrine of substance over form into sharp focus and highlights the ambiguity that arises when tax laws are interpreted expansively. Much like the Vodafone case, where the Court initially ruled in favour of the taxpayer before Parliament retrospectively amended the law citing misinterpretation, the present ruling underscores how judicial interpretation can significantly alter tax outcomes for offshore transactions. By holding that the value of Flipkart Singapore was substantially derived from underlying assets located in India, the Court effectively brought an offshore share transfer within the Indian tax net, despite the absence of direct geographical nexus.

Surge in silver prices

Apropos, ‘You now have to pay ₹3 lakh for a kg of silver’ (January 20). Escalating silver prices strain household budgets particularly during festival and wedding seasons, and adversely affect small jewellers and artisans. For industries reliant on silver, higher raw material costs may be passed on to consumers, fuelling broader price pressures.

Textiles’ multiplier effect

This refers to ‘Textiles sector driving growth, jobs’ (January 20). Textiles are semi-durable goods which means they have perpetual demand. What is impressive is that the increase in demand for textiles (consumer goods) stimulates the demand for sewing machines (capital goods), and boosts employment opportunities, income and output in the economy. Also, they earn considerable foreign exchange through exports. In short, they have a multiplier effect.

SEZ reforms

This refers to ‘Govt mulls reforms to help SEZs leverage home market’ (January 20). Allowing SEZs to do reverse job work would give immense relief to them, which have been facing turbulent times, especially after the Trump tariff shocks. While the operationalised Export Promotion Mission would improve SEZs competitiveness, it is essential these units are assisted in moving away from their over-dependence on the US market.

Further, SEZ units may be incentivised to upgrade technologically and vigorously pursue R&D.
